Bio

Isabela is a lawyer and an LLM candidate in international human rights law at the University of Sussex in the United Kingdom. She has experience working on UN international instruments, field work with rural communities and youth leadership. Isabela believes in education as a human right and has founded her own consulting firm where she seeks to close the educational access gap for Latin American youth.

What ignited your pursuit for gender equality?

Coming from a peasant family, a victim of the armed conflict, and living in a country with a conservative and patriarchal culture made me want to work for a better country and ensure that no one else is affected by injustice and social bias. Also, it has allowed me to recognize women as community leaders and the central axis of peacebuilding.

Please share your biggest wins as an advocate for gender equality.

Thanks to my experience, leadership, and recognition in my region, I was selected by the UN WOMEN office for Latin America and the Caribbean as a young consultant on the application of the Beijing Declaration and Platform for Action, in the 25 years of its creation, to carry the voice of the young women of Latin America and expose our realities.
